Better than Grandma’s Homemade Pasta Sauce

Don’t tell grandma, but we made a pasta sauce that will rock your socks. Made with just a few simple ingredients and some easy preparation, you’ve got yourself a new sauce recipe for pasta night with the family! AND, its a crockpot recipe, so you can just SET IT AND FORGET IT!

Ingredients:

4 links (1 pkg.) Greenridge Farm Black Forest Sausages, roughly diced

1 lb ground Italian sausage

1 small yellow or white onion, diced

1 (32 oz) can whole peeled San Marzano tomatoes

1 cup whole milk

1/3 cup tomato paste

2 cloves garlic, minced

1 bay leaf

1 tsp oregano

1 tsp red pepper flakes

sea salt and fresh cracked pepper

 

InSTRUCTIONs:

  1. Heat large skillet over medium heat and add diced Black Forest Sausages, Italian sausage and onion. Season with sea salt and pepper. Cook, breaking up the Italian sausages with a wooden spoon until the meat is browned and onion is soft about 6-9 minutes.
  2. Remove from skillet and transfer to crock pot. Add in remaining ingredients and give it a good stir until everything is combined.
  3. Set heat to LOW on crockpot and cook for 6-8 hours or 3-4 on HIGH. (we recommend the LOW setting, it allows for all the aromas and flavors to fully incorporate in the sauce.) Stir sauce once or twice an hour.
  4. If your sauce is soupy, add in a little bit more tomato paste and turn heat up to high and cook for 30 additional minutes until thickened. If your sauce is too thick, add 1/4 cup of water and continue cooking on low until you’ve reached your desired consistency.
  5. Remove bay leaf and serve on your favorite pasta. Enjoy 🙂
